For lots of, Indian theatre navigated an area between regional languages and English diversifications. The latter, incessantly a carbon replica of Western productions, left a void for a in point of fact indigenous voice. Acclaimed theatre director Lillete Dubey felt this acutely when she based The Primetime Theatre Corporate in 1991.
“The English theatre scene used to be too English,” Dubey says. “I felt alienated, repeatedly calling myself Martha or Jane and having a husband named Russell. So, we began with what I name midway homes — Western performs tailored to an Indian context. The target audience’s response to those slight tweaks used to be encouraging. I realised we had to in finding our personal voice in Indian-English theatre.”
This pursuit led her to an not going collaborator in Sandeep Kanjilal, an M.Tech from IIT Delhi, a self-taught musician harbouring a dream. He had written a musical, a daring reimagining of Mahabharata as a rock opera. However it remained unproduced for over a decade. “After I met him in ’96,” Dubey remembers, “I cherished the idea that.”
On the other hand, the undertaking introduced a singular problem. Despite the fact that Kanjilal had composed the track and written the lyrics, the whole lot remained in his head – unproduced and unrecorded. Important sources have been wanted for recording and general manufacturing.
In spite of the hurdles, Dubey continued. In 1998, her imaginative and prescient got here to existence with the grand opening of Jaya. It used to be an enormous enterprise – an open-air manufacturing sprawling throughout 10,000 sq. toes, incorporating herbal water our bodies and bushes for an immersive enjoy. The preliminary reaction used to be excellent, with a success runs in Bangalore and Kolkata.
Destiny intervened and the play used to be pressured to near upfront. Dubey, alternatively, didn’t relinquish the dream of reviving this groundbreaking manufacturing. Sadly, her movie commitments within the following years put the undertaking on dangle once more. Later, the pandemic interrupted its revival.
After just about 3 a long time of ready, Jaya is in the end again on level.
Jaya is a daring reimagining of the Mahabharata that blends the traditional epic with the electrical power of rock track and the artwork varieties of Kathak and Kalari. The narrative unfolds during the eyes of Yudhishthira, the eldest Pandava, as he grapples with the complexities of fact, energy, and future. The play contrasts his beliefs with the opposing philosophies of Duryodhana and Karna, making a dynamic exploration of human nature. With a formidable unique rating, electrifying performances, and surprising visuals, Jaya is a modern interpretation of a undying tale that resonates with lately’s audiences.

In step with Dubey, the Mahabharata, in spite of being advised and retold 1000’s of instances all the way through Indian historical past, nonetheless holds nice relevance and pastime.
“Myths and epics are so tough. Other folks need to pay attention them time and again. That’s why the Ramleela occurs annually. Other folks crave it. It’s a basic human wish to undergo one thing acquainted, get catharsis, find out about excellent and evil… Whilst getting ready the play, I saved occupied with the conflicts in Gaza and Israel, Ukraine and Russia. In essence, it’s identical. The Mahabharat, for instance, is set now not in need of to surrender the land that rightfully belonged to anyone. And I like the way it’s written as a result of everybody has an overly legitimate perspective.“
Jaya‘s manufacturing boasts an excellent lineup of abilities. Lighting fixtures by means of Lynne Fernandes from the Nrityagram Dance Ensemble and units by means of Fali Unwalla try to create a visible spectacle. The costumes are by means of Pallavi Patel. Main the forged are Sherrin Verghese, Megan Murray, and 2Blue. Vikrant Chatturvedi, Asif Ali Beg, Keshia B, Sid Makker, Varun Narayan, and Ujjaiynee Roy enrich the ensemble with their numerous abilities. The unique track rating is by means of Ashutosh Phatak, and the choreography is by means of Guru Arpit Singh and Pooja Pant.
